Output efef8d43cc4a362b7b977ef05cae8a60b94a99d3ff956d3f6bb94fb5bee7ea9f:0

value
3281516
script pubkey
OP_0 OP_PUSHBYTES_20 818238823ab070c8a76b64b838ce606829c6adec
address
bc1qsxpr3q36kpcv3fmtvjur3nnqdq5udt0v97as7z
transaction
efef8d43cc4a362b7b977ef05cae8a60b94a99d3ff956d3f6bb94fb5bee7ea9f
confirmations
307908
spent
true